THE KNAPPIES The Knappies Mr Allerdes Tillyminnate
Mr J Adam Corrylair
Mr J. Smith Coynachie
033 Three peculiar looking hillocks about 6 feet in height covered with Rough Pasture, situated on the rising ground S.E. [South East] of the farm of Corrylair; they appear to be artificial, but no information relating to their origin can be obtained.
